Document: Medical records of 185 dogs, which had undergone single or multiple VSD based on clinical signs (nonâ€ambulatory tetraparesis/plegia) and MRI results between January 2010 and September 2016 at a single veterinary practice were reviewed. Data about signalment, preoperative neurological status, intervertebral disc(s) involved, outcome (good: ambulatory, fair: ambulatory but with perceivable neurological deficit, poor: nonâ€ambulatory or perioperative death), time to recovery (TTR), and neurological status at the ‘last seen’ date were collected.
